Clever FFmpeg GUI is a small, but smart GUI for FFmpeg.
It processes Audio and Video streams separately. These can be muxed after processing.
It's for Windows Systems, portable, x86, x64, ARM. Requires .NET Framework.

No installation required. Extract and use it.
(Read the ReadMe.txt)

Automatic stream detection, Video, Audio and Subtitle stream conversion, Video, Audio and Subtitle stream extraction, Audio volume detection,
Audio length and pitch modification, automatic Video crop detection, Audio and Video Fade In and Fade Out,
Change aspect ratio (at Stream level too, for avc, hevc amnd mpeg2), Change Audio and Subtitles stream language,
Change profile level without recoding (for x264 and hevc).
Cut on Keyframes.
HDR10 recoding while keeping HDR10 metadata (with H.265 codec) and HDR10 to SDR with tonemap and desaturation for all avaiable codecs.
3D Look-Up Tables (LUTs) support in Video encoding.
Batch processing.

DVD movie rip implemented (unprotected DVD's only).
Point to VOB 1 of a Title Set (g.e. VTS_01_1.VOB for Titleset 1), answer Yes to the questions and the entire movie will be ripped and imported.

Video Stream Encoding to: mpeg1, mpeg2, Theora, x264 (avc), x265 (hevc), Divx, ffv1, Xvid, VP8, VP9, DNxHD, DNxHR, AV1, wmv1, wmv2, prores.
Audio Stream Encoding to: aac, ac3, eac3, dts, flac, mp2, mp3, opus, vorbis, pcm, trueHD.
Multiplex to: 3gp, asf, avi, flv, m2ts, mov, mpg, mp4, mkv, ogg, ts, vob, mfx, webm, wmv.
Hardcoding Subtitles: ass, ssa, srt, vobsub, pgs (pgs only if present in the source video, not from external files).
Chapters: support for 3gp, mkv, mp4, mov, webm.

Special features:

With TV Rips with AC3 6ch audio it happens that the first frames have only 2 ch. In the encode audiostream section there is a button for this. If it is selected, the target file will be patched to full 6 ch. This button is only available if the source file is or contains an AC3 6ch file.

Another great thing is that you can convert the soundtrack of a 25 FPS PAL movie to an e.g. 23.976 FPS NTSC soundtrack or vice versa and, if desired, also adjust the audio pitch.
